The Epic Australia Pass is now available to purchase for the 2024 winter season providing unlimited, unrestricted access to Perisher, Falls Creek and Hotham, as well as access to bucket-list resorts across the world including Whistler Blackcomb, Vail, Park City and Andermatt-Sedrun-Disentis.

Priced (until tomorrow) at AU$959 for adults, the Epic Australia Pass pays for itself in just five days.

The Epic Australia Pass is priced at AU$549 for students (up to year 12), AU$749 for senior (65+) and starting at AU$579 for adaptive. Skiers and riders can access their favourite resorts for just AU$49 upfront, with the remainder of the balance payable in early May 2024.

2024 Epic Australia Pass access begins with the 2024 Australian snow season and concludes with the 2024/25 snow season in the Northern Hemisphere.

Unlimited, unrestricted access to Perisher, Falls Creek and Hotham for the 2024 snow season

Access to world-class resorts for the 2024/25 Northern Hemisphere snow season, including: 10 combined days at Beaver Creek, Vail and Whistler Blackcomb; plus unlimited access excluding peak dates at Breckenridge, Keystone, Park City, Heavenly, Northstar, Kirkwood, Stowe and five combined days at Canada’s Fernie Alpine Resort, Kicking Horse Mountain Resort and Kimberley Alpine Resort, Nakiska and Mont-Sainte-Anne.

Did we mention Japan? Five consecutive days in each at Hakuba Valley and Rusutsu.

In Switzerland you’ll get five days at Andermatt-Sedrun-Disentis plus more offers in Austria, France and Italy.

But wait, there’s more:

  • Six Bring-A-Mate discount invitations for up to 50 percent off single day lift tickets for friends and family
  • 20 percent off lessons and rentals
  • 15 percent off all purchases at select retail outlets at Perisher, Falls Creek and Hotham
  • Lodging and on-mountain dining discounts at Perisher and Hotham
  • Access to First Tracks at Perisher and Hotham
  • In-resort benefits with Epic Mountain Rewards at North American resorts, which includes 20 per cent off lodging, on-mountain dining, rentals, group lessons and more during the 2024/25 season
